			<content:encoded><![CDATA[<p>The doctoral dissertation of Licentiate in Philosophy <strong>Eini Niskanen</strong> entitled <em>“<a href="http://www.uef.fi/uef/vaitostiedotteet1?p_p_id=101_INSTANCE_iQ9J&#038;p_p_lifecycle=0&#038;p_p_state=normal&#038;p_p_mode=view&#038;p_p_col_id=column-2&#038;p_p_col_pos=1&#038;p_p_col_count=2&#038;_101_INSTANCE_iQ9J_struts_action=%2Fasset_publisher%2Fview_content&#038;_101_INSTANCE_iQ9J_urlTitle=20120113-erilaisten-aivotutkimusmenetelmien&#038;_101_INSTANCE_iQ9J_type=content&#038;redirect=%2Fuef%2Fvaitostiedotteet" target="_blank">Human brain mapping using structural and functional magnetic resonance imaging and transcranial magnetic stimulation</a>”</em> has been examined on 13th January. The aim of the study was to develop analysis methods of TMS and functional and structural MRI to study the brain areas related to motor functions, speech and language. The findings demonstrate the advantages of combining different methods and modalities in brain research.</p>
<p>The <a href="http://www.megaemg.com/products/biomonitor-me6000/" title="ME6000">ME6000 system</a>, developed by Mega Electronics, was used in the transcranial magnetic stimulation (TMS) studies to define the motor threshold for finding out optimal stimulation intensity.</p>

			<content:encoded><![CDATA[<p>Handheld force sensor is the latest addition to long list of optional sensors for ME6000. Handheld force sensor is ideal for quick assessments of force production capability during manual muscle testing. The patient is instructed to hold limb in position and resist gradually increasing force applied by the examiner. The force required to move the limb is referred as the “breaking force”. Electromyographic activity of agonist and antagonist muscles can be measured simultaneously with force measurements.</p>

			<content:encoded><![CDATA[<p><a href="http://www.megaemg.com/products/neurone-eeg-system/">NeurOne</a> with MRI compatibility launched at <a href="http://www.megaemg.com/events/medica/">Medica 2011</a>. </p>
<p><strong>NeurOne Tesla brings unique features of NeurOne EEG/ERP to the researchers of fMRI.<br />
  These features include:</strong></p>
<p>  • 40 &#8211; 160 channels<br />
             • up to 152 channels of EEG<br />
             • 8 &#8211; 32 bipolar channels<br />
  • DC/AC mode; settable channel by channel<br />
  • High dynamic range (+/-430 mV or +/-86 mV)<br />
  • High sampling rate (max. 80 kHz)<br />
  • 24 bit resolution<br />
  • Battery powered<br />
  • Fiber optic connection from Tesla Amplifier to MRI control room<br />
  • Real Time analog out (any 16 channels of 160)<br />
  • Windows 7 compatible software<br />
  • MATLAB/EEGLAB support<br />
  • Supported directly by BESA/Vision Analyzer </p>
